Compare all specifications:

1962 DKW Munga 2008 Toyota Tundra
Make DKW Toyota
Model Munga Tundra
Year Released 1962 2008
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 979 cc 5663 cc
Engine Cylinders 3 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 43 HP 382 HP
Engine RPM 4500 RPM 5600 RPM
Torque RPM 3000 RPM 3600 RPM
Engine Compression Ratio 8.0:1 10.2:1
Drive Type 4WD 4WD
Vehicle Weight 1110 kg 1330 kg
Vehicle Length 3450 mm 6300 mm
Vehicle Width 1820 mm 2040 mm
Vehicle Height 1760 mm 1950 mm
Wheelbase Size 2010 mm 4190 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 31 L 100 L
